Convert 96 14/10000 as an improper fraction

To turn the mixed number 96 14/10000 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:

First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 96 × 10000 = 960000.

After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 960000 + 14 = 960014.

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 960014/10000.

This means that 96 14/10000, as an improper fraction, equals 960014/10000.
